I won't record another Bond theme and jinx it: Adele
LONDON: Singer Adele will never record another James Bond theme, even though her "Skyfall" anthem won her an Oscar.

The 27-year-old singer said the success of her 007 tune, which became the first Bond theme to win an Academy Award, will be tough to beat and therefore she'd rather not try, reported Contactmusic.

"I would never do it again because it went so well and I would never want to jinx it," Adele said.

And she admits she came close to turning down the opportunity following the success of her 2011 album 21, but she could hear destiny calling.

"I was like, 'Why did I want to ruin things (and record a Bond theme)?'" she recalled.

"Then I heard it was (the 23rd Bond film), and I was 23, and it felt a little like fate."
